Framework de plugins da Epic Games para transmitir dados em tempo real para a Unreal Engine de fontes externas – incluindo sistemas de motion capture, câmeras virtuais, face tracking e dados de animação, permitindo prévia e gravação imediata de performances em produção virtual.
O que é Live Link?
Live Link é o framework de plugins da Epic Games para Unreal Engine, que transmite dados em tempo real de fontes externas para o motor. Ele forma a espinha dorsal para produção virtual, captura de movimento e sistemas de pré-visualização interativa.
Princípio Básico
| Aspecto | Descrição |
|---|---|
| Função | Transmissão de dados em tempo real |
| Plataforma | Unreal Engine |
| Protocolo | Baseado em UDP |
| Latência | Mínima (faixa de ms) |
Fontes de Dados Suportadas
| Fonte | Aplicação |
|---|---|
| Captura de Movimento | Vicon, OptiTrack, Xsens |
| Rastreamento Facial | iPhone, ARKit |
| Câmera Virtual | iPad, iPhone |
| Superfícies de Controle | Mesas de luz, faders |
Arquitetura
| Componente | Função |
|---|---|
| Fonte | Fonte de dados (externa) |
| Sujeito | Fluxo de dados individual |
| Plugin | Específico da fonte |
| Cliente | Unreal Engine |
Integração de Captura de Movimento
| Sistema | Suporte Live Link |
|---|---|
| Vicon | Plugin Nativo |
| OptiTrack | Plugin Motive |
| Xsens | Plugin MVN |
| Rokoko | Plugin Studio |
Câmera Virtual
| Recurso | Descrição |
|---|---|
| App vCam | Aplicativo iOS |
| Rastreamento | Dispositivo para câmera UE |
| Pré-visualização | Tempo real no dispositivo |
| Gravação | Baseada em take |
Rastreamento Facial
| Método | Descrição |
|---|---|
| ARKit | iPhone TrueDepth |
| LiveLink Face | App dedicado |
| Audio2Face | Integração NVIDIA |
| Faceware | Profissional |
Fluxo de Trabalho
| Etapa | Descrição |
|---|---|
| 1 | Ativar plugin |
| 2 | Configurar fonte |
| 3 | Atribuir sujeito |
| 4 | Receber animação |
Tipos de Sujeito
| Tipo | Dados |
|---|---|
| Animação | Poses de esqueleto |
| Transformação | Posição/Rotação |
| Câmera | Parâmetros da câmera |
| Luz | Valores de luz |
Retargeting
| Aspecto | Descrição |
|---|---|
| Esqueleto Fonte | Rig de mocap |
| Esqueleto Alvo | Personagem UE |
| Mapeamento | Atribuição de ossos |
| Pré-processamento | Filtros, offsets |
Integração com Blueprint
| Função | Descrição |
|---|---|
| Obter Sujeitos | Fontes disponíveis |
| Avaliar | Dados atuais |
| Gravar | Iniciar gravação |
| Reproduzir | Reprodução |
Timecode
| Aspecto | Descrição |
|---|---|
| Sincronização | Genlock/Timecode |
| Provedor | Sinal externo |
| Gravação | Com Timecode |
| Reprodução | Sincronizada |
Configuração de Produção Virtual
| Elemento | Função |
|---|---|
| nDisplay | Cluster de tela LED |
| Live Link | Dados de rastreamento |
| Genlock | Sincronização da câmera |
| Timecode | Sincronização de gravação |
Presets
| Tipo de Preset | Aplicação |
|---|---|
| Presets de Fonte | Configuração de fontes |
| Presets de Sujeito | Atribuições |
| Assets de Retargeting | Mapeamento de ossos |
| BP de Animação | Processamento |
Otimização de Latência
| Medida | Descrição |
|---|---|
| Tamanho do Buffer | Mínimo |
| Rede | LAN dedicada |
| Timecode | Genlock |
| Interpolação | Opcional |
Solução de Problemas
| Problema | Solução |
|---|---|
| Sem Sujeito | Firewall, rede |
| Jitter | Ajustar buffer |
| Drift | Verificar timecode |
| Lag | Otimizar rede |
Plugins
| Plugin | Aplicação |
|---|---|
| LiveLinkVicon | Sistemas Vicon |
| LiveLinkOptiTrack | OptiTrack |
| LiveLinkXR | Headsets XR |
| LiveLinkOSC | Protocolo OSC |
Gravação
| Aspecto | Descrição |
|---|---|
| Take Recorder | Gravar em UE |
| Sequencer | Salvar animação |
| Sequência de Nível | Para reprodução |
| Baking | Animação final |
Melhores Práticas
| Prática | Motivo |
|---|---|
| Rede Dedicada | Estabilidade |
| Sincronização de Timecode | Multi-fonte |
| Testar antes da filmagem | Identificar problemas |
| Gravação de Backup | Segurança |
Hoje
O Live Link se tornou a tecnologia padrão para fluxos de trabalho em tempo real na Unreal Engine. De pequenos projetos independentes com rastreamento de iPhone a grandes palcos de produção virtual com sistemas profissionais de captura de movimento, a capacidade de integrar fluxos de dados externos de forma contínua está revolucionando a produção de filmes e jogos.